WebWaqf under Islāmic law is very similar to a trust under common law. Both involve the concept of separating the legal and beneficial title. The two devices are parallel in purpose, theory and structure. Web14 Jan 2024 · Here is a list of the most common reasons for setting up a trust according to the Government’s trust and taxes guidelines: To control and protect family assets. If someone is too young to handle their affairs. If someone cannot handle their affairs due to being incapacitated. To pass on assets while still being alive.
